Извлечение удаленных объектов добавляет "_ $$ _ javassist_x" в тип - PullRequest
0 голосов
/ 05 января 2010

у нас есть клиент-серверное приложение (Flex и Java), которое использует BlazeDS для удаленного взаимодействия. Это позволяет нам обмениваться и отображать типы между клиентом и сервером. По какой-то причине тип пользователя, который мы получаем с сервера, отправляется не как «пользователь», а как «пользователь _ $$ _ javassist_x», где х - целое число.

Все остальные типы, которые мы отправляем, работают нормально, даже пользовательский тип, используемый в другом классе обслуживания.

Есть идеи?

1 Ответ

0 голосов
/ 05 января 2010

Очевидно, что объекты User были частью коллекции, которая была загружена с отложенной загрузкой. После установки атрибута lazy в false в отображении Hibernate все работало нормально.

...